vs2013怎么连接mysql mvc怎么修改web.config来连接mysql数据库

6787 阅读

vs2013怎样通过web.config配置连接mysql数据库

说到用vs2013连接mysql,咱们首先得搞明白,最常用的做法就是在web.config里写连接字符串。一般来说,这个配置文件是以XML格式存在的,专门用来存放各种配置,比如数据库连接啥的。你可以在<connectionStrings>节点下加上你的连接配置,样子基本是这样的:

<connectionStrings>
  <add name="MySqlConnection" connectionString="server=localhost;user id=root;password=12345;database=testdb" providerName="MySql.Data.MySqlClient" />
</connectionStrings>

这样一来,后续代码中调用起来特别方便,直接用 ConfigurationManager.ConnectionStrings["MySqlConnection"].ConnectionString 就能拿到连接信息,是不是贼方便呀!别忘了,得先引用System.Configuration命名空间,别到时候傻傻找不到。

而且,写在web.config里面也特别好管理,毕竟数据库密码啥的放这儿也算比较安全,不用每个页面去改,改一次全局生效,别提多秀了。

web.config配置数据库

mvc要怎么修改web.config来连接mysql数据库 和 常用的数据库连接方式

好啦,咱们再来说说mvc里怎么搞。其实跟vs2013差不多,咱们一般还是把数据库连接字符串写在web.config的connectionStrings节点下。为啥要这么干呢?嘿嘿,这里就得讲讲好处:

  1. 统一管理连接信息:你要是改了数据库地址或者账号密码,只改一个文件就完事儿,简直节省一大堆麻烦!
  2. 代码简洁明了:程序里直接通过配置名访问,代码也更清爽。
  3. 灵活性高:以后换数据库类型,比如换成SQL Server啥的,也只要改配置,不用改代码。

说到数据库连接方式,简单给你罗列几个最火的哈:

  1. web.config配置字符串+ConfigurationManager读取
    这是最主流的,咱们刚才说的。

  2. 代码里写连接字符串
    这个不太推荐,没法统一管理,麻烦得很,容易泄露密码啥的。

  3. 用数据源控件拖拽(比如SqlDataSource)
    有些开发工具支持,你直接拖一个数据源控件到页面上配置,会自动帮你把连接字符串添加到web.config里,省心省事。

其实,这些方式不管哪个,最终目的都是减少重复代码,让数据库连接更灵活更安全。总的来说,把连接字符串写在web.config里面,配合C#的ConfigurationManager来读取,几乎是当下最牛的做法。

web.config配置数据库

相关问题解答

  1. vs2013里连接mysql最简单的方式是什么?
    嘿,亲,这个超简单!你只要在web.config的<connectionStrings>标签里写上你的mysql连接字符串,然后在代码中用ConfigurationManager.ConnectionStrings来取,一切马上搞定。超级方便,根本不用瞎折腾代码,轻松上手!

  2. 为什么推荐把数据库连接字符串放到web.config文件中?
    哎呀,你看啊,把连接字符串放web.config里最大的好处就是管理方便,改了配置信息不用找代码一页一页地改,瞬间全项目生效,省时省力超省心!而且安全也更有保障,别再把密码写死代码里啦,太掉链子了。

  3. mvc项目里如果更换数据库,只改web.config够吗?
    这问题问得太妙了!多数情况下,只要你的项目代码用的都是ConfigurationManager取连接字符串,改改web.config就好了,根本不用动代码。只要数据库类型和驱动没变,真的,改完配置立马奏效,不用慌。

  4. 数据源控件拖拽配置会自动修改web.config,靠谱吗?
    放心吧,这玩意儿真是能帮很大忙!你拖个SqlDataSource控件,配置完数据库连接,它会自动把连接字符串塞到web.config里,少犯错又方便,特别适合不太喜欢写代码的小白。不过,得留意别随便乱动配置文件哈,以免搞崩溃咯。

发表评论

胥祥 2025-12-06
我发布了文章《vs2013怎么连接mysql mvc怎么修改web.config来连接mysql数据库》,希望对大家有用!欢迎在生活百科中查看更多精彩内容。
用户117537 1小时前
关于《vs2013怎么连接mysql mvc怎么修改web.config来连接mysql数据库》这篇文章,作者胥祥的观点很有见地,特别是内容分析这部分,让我受益匪浅!
用户117538 1天前
在生活百科看到这篇2025-12-06发布的文章,内容详实,逻辑清晰,对我很有帮助。感谢胥祥的分享!